•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:【ACCESS】同じパラメータを省略する方法は?)

【ACCESS】同じパラメータを省略する方法は?

このQ&Aのポイント
  • ACCESSで同じパラメータを省略する方法について教えてください。
  • マクロを使用して複数のクエリを実行する際に、同じパラメータを一度の入力で済ませたいです。
  • 初心者でも分かりやすい方法があれば教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• nda23
  • ベストアンサー率54% (777/1415)
回答No.1

フォームを作り、日付×2と事業所CDを記録する テキストボックス、及び実行ボタンを配置します。 実行ボタンのクリック時で、マクロを実行する ようにします。 フォームをF、開始日をS、終了日をE、事業所を Jとすると、クエリの方は以下のようにします。 売上日付 BETWEEN Forms!F!S AND Forms!F!E AND 事業所cd=Forms!F!J 別法は質問者さんがやったようにパラメータ用の テーブルを使う方法です。 テーブルをTとして、他はフォームと同じとします。 クエリは以下の通りです。 SELECT ~ FROM 実テーブル AS A INNER JOIN T ON A.売上日付>=T.S AND A.売上日付<=T.E AND A.事業所cd=T.J

AQPL11
質問者

お礼

ご回答ありがとうございました。 早速実行してみています。 また何かありましたら宜しくお願い致します。

関連するQ&A